Frequently asked questions about The Friends Of Halifax Minster

What does The Friends Of Halifax Minster do?

To provide funds for the maintenance repair and conservation of the fabric of the Minster Church of St.John the Baptist Halifax

How much income did The Friends Of Halifax Minster report in 2025?

The Friends Of Halifax Minster reported total income of £79k and reported expenditure of £88k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was The Friends Of Halifax Minster registered as a charity?

The Friends Of Halifax Minster was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 30 September 2004 as charity number 1106122. It has been registered for 22 years.

Who runs The Friends Of Halifax Minster?

The Friends Of Halifax Minster is governed by a board of 8 trustees. The chair of trustees is The Revd Canon Hilary John Barber.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does The Friends Of Halifax Minster operate?

The Friends Of Halifax Minster operates in Calderdale,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is The Friends Of Halifax Minster a registered charity?

Yes — The Friends Of Halifax Minster is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1106122.
